'If Pakistan...': Indian Army chief's message days after Imran Khan's J&K remark
Published on Jun 03, 2021 08:56 pm IST
- Chief of Staff of the Indian Army, General MM Naravane issued a clear message to Pakistan. Speaking days after the neighbouring country's Prime Minister, Imran Khan, said that the two nations can return to the talks table only after India has restored Jammu & Kashmir's special status, General Naravane said that there is a lot of mistrust between the two nations. He added that in order to 'incrementally' build up trust, Pakistan will have to strictly adhere to the ceasefire pact along the disputed border, and also stop sending terrorists to foment trouble in India.
